The tide and the ebb phenomenon

The water represents 71 % of the Earth surface, the tide and the ebb phenomenon occur in the water surfaces (the oceans, The seas & the lakes).

The tide and the ebb phenomenon occurs due to the attraction force between the Moon, The Earth, and the Sun, But the Moon is more effective than the Sun as it is nearer to the Earth.

The tide is the rise of the water level in the water surfaces to cover the seashores, The maximum rising of the water level (tide) is in the half of the lunar month (at the full moon phase), and The ebb is the return back of the water to its normal level after the tide.

  The benefits of the tide and the ebb 
  1. We can generate the electricity as the flowing and the retraction of the water during the tide and the ebb produces the energy that is used in operating the turbines to produce the electricity.

  2. The water currents result from the tide and the ebb causes the water canals to remain deep.

  3. They clean the coasts as during the tide and the ebb, the water of the seas carries the wastes from the coasts to the bottom of the sea, where they are settled.

  4. The water currents resulted from the tide and the ebb help the ships and the boats to move through the shallow water paths.

The bad effects of the tide and the ebb phenomenon 

 It causes some bad effects such as decaying of the beaches.
